New LAND project open for applications

The promised LAND!

The Permaculture Association is excited to announce that the LAND project is now open for applications.

LAND is funded by the Big Lottery's Local Food Scheme to enhance the food growing, land design skills and knowledge of permaculture practitioners and the general public throughout England.

We are looking for 80 demonstration sites to be part of the network by 2012. Projects can be big or small, at home or in the community. The most important thing is that you are willing to engage with volunteers and visitors and be an accessible demonstration of permaculture principles and methods.

We are hoping that members will want to get involved in making LAND a great success, and right now we need your help to update our list of designers, projects and aspiring teachers.

So if you offer design services, want to run local presentations or introductory courses, or have a project but haven't publicised it much yet, do let us know.

LAND events lined up for this year include:

  • LAND launch - September 11th - 12th 2009 (find out more)
  • National Conference with Diploma presentations, workshops, networking and the Association's AGM - October 17th 2009
  • Regional networking and skill-sharing events and a diverse training programme will begin in November 2009.

Permaculture Area @ The Big Green Gathering 2009

If you are missing not having a convergence this year, why not come to the Big Green Gathering? Its big, its green and it’s a gathering of loads of lovely like minded people (20,000 of them). The permaculture area there is virtually a festival within itself, taking up a whole field full of workshops, information stalls, places to meet new people and the permaculture sunken garden.

As usual we have so much to do and see and fabulous people to meet, you may never be the same again. There will be over 100 workshops on all things self-sufficient and ecological living, with plenty of stalls and information as ever. And of course the brilliant Fernhill Farm’s Permaculture Garden, where there will be loads of fabulous practical workshops and a great demonstration of a developing garden, come and get your hands dirty.

Find out about how to design your own living space, to reduce your impact and have more fun. Learn how to increase your chances for planning permission; see how others have set up local food projects. Learn from Patrick Whitefield about how to read the landscape; have a tour of the new waste recycling wetland system, ask the BBC Gardeners World’s Alys Fowler about her winter greens and maybe get on the telly while the BBC films the area, hear about Urban Food growing projects all over the country. The Heritage seed library will be there with lots of great workshops including guys from Garden Organic. Visit the Natural Living Collective for every thing from positive births to natural burials. Come along to the Transition culture showcase and learn from eachother’s experiences and enjoy a cup of wild tea. Hear Pauls Mobbs' latest research on peak oil.
